WebMarten (1990) developed anxiety traits (A-trait) questionnaires that were tailored specially to a sport known as the Sport Competition Anxiety Test . Marten (1990) [3] recognised that any measure of sports anxiety must take into consideration cognitive anxiety (negative thoughts, worry) and somatic anxiety (physiological response).
WebThis scale is a multidimensional measure of cognitive and somatic trait anxiety in sport performance settings. It is suitable for use with both children and adults, and consists of three separate 5-item subscales for somatic anxiety, worry, and concentration disruption. Items are anchored on a 4-point Likert scale. (SCAT) A test measuring the tendency of an athlete to experience anxiety when competing in a sport. It is used to measure competitive trait anxiety. Test scoring is based on 10 questions that ask individuals how they feel when competing in sports and games.
